Crafting Visual Harmony: The Design Story of This White Wedding Cake
Our approach to creating this specific Utah wedding cake began with a deep appreciation for textural artistry within a monochromatic scheme. The design features two perfectly stacked tiers, each enveloped in a pristine white buttercream. The beauty of this cake lies in its subtle yet captivating details, particularly the horizontal textured finish applied to the buttercream. This technique creates delicate ridges and valleys across the surface of each tier, catching the light in a way that adds dimension and visual interest without relying on color or elaborate embellishments. The texture is consistent across both tiers, providing a unified and sophisticated look. This horizontal texturing lends a sense of movement and fluidity, softening the structured form of the cake and inviting closer inspection. Investing in Your Utah Wedding Cake: Understanding Our Tiers of Luxury
We believe that your wedding cake should be an exquisite reflection of your unique celebration, a luxurious centerpiece that delights both the eye and the palate. To help you plan for this significant detail, we offer transparent investment guidance for our custom creations. Our two-tier cakes, like the beautiful white design featured, begin at $450, representing an ideal choice for intimate gatherings or as a striking accent for larger events. For grander celebrations, our three-tier designs start at $650, offering a more substantial presence and additional servings. Should your guest list or design aspirations call for an even more magnificent statement, our four and five-tier custom designs begin at $875, ensuring a truly breathtaking focal point for your reception. The Flavors
Flavour is chosen at your tasting, where you select three cakes and three fillings from the full Sweet E’s menu. Signature options include vanilla bean, almond, lemon and salted caramel, each paired with buttercreams, curds and ganaches that suit the design. Vegan, dairy free and gluten friendly versions are available for most cakes, so tell us about any dietary needs when you inquire and we will build them into your quote.
Questions Couples Ask
How far in advance should I book my Utah wedding cake?
We recommend booking your custom wedding cake six to twelve months in advance, especially for peak wedding seasons. This allows ample time for design consultations, tasting appointments, and ensures our availability for your special date. Earlier booking is always encouraged to secure your preferred date.
Do you offer tastings for custom wedding cakes?
Yes, we offer private tasting experiences for $50, which include three cake flavors and three filling options. This fee is complimentary with any custom cake order over $300, providing an opportunity to savor our delicious creations before making your final selections.
